#40 Heavy-Duty Steel Sprocket with 3/4-Inch bore is commonly used for 3/4-Inch jackshafts, gearboxes, and half axles.Â
The Type B Sprocket allows the sprocket to be mounted in-board close to your machinery, bearing hangers, or engine for better load support or mount out-board for fitment or clearance. The #40 pitch had a much higher tensile strength(3,700lbs or greater) over the #35 pitch(2,100lbs or greater)Â roller chains for higher output machines.Â
The Sprocket Hub has two set screws to help hold the sprocket on the 3/4 shaft and 1/4 keyway.
